I am looking for a family physician associate to join my family practice. This physician would have their ownset of unique patients so they can bill using the LFP model. The associate can work in the office 2-2.5 daysper week when I am not in the office and can work virtual for the other 2-2.5 days. Our office and I wouldactively help build the associate's medical practice. We receive many calls daily from the public inquiringabout acceptance of new patients but I also have 2000 patients who can help spread the word about a newdoctor accepting patients.

Renumeration depends on hours worked and their LFP billing to GOV BC but can range up to potentially $800,000 plus with bonuses once the practice is established.
Physician Overhead
For the first 1- 1.5 years, while the associate is building their practice, I would only expect 20% of billings tocontribute to the overhead. Once the associate's practice is established their would an expectation to sharehalf of the costs of the rent. payment of staff, medical supply costs, parking fees, etc.

Nestled in the estuary at the mouth of the historic Fraser River, the city of Richmond offers a unique blend of urban sophistication and rural tranquility. A cosmopolitan population, proximity to all kinds of transportation options, sunny weather and endless riverside walking paths make Richmond a marvelous place to live, work and play. Just minutes from downtown Vancouver and close to the U.S. border, Richmond is a convenient location that serves up culture, amazing cuisine, and authentic experiences.
